THE POSITION
Start a new and exciting chapter in your career as an Administrative Officer 1! The Office of Children, Youth and Families is seeking an experienced and detail-oriented individual to function as the training lead for clerical staff of the Division of Operations. In this role, you will ensure the ability and proficiency of staff that perform all clerical activities within the division. If you are excited to use your experience in a rewarding way and utilize your creativity to develop training curriculum, apply today!
DESCRIPTION OF WORK
As an Administrative Officer 1, you will be responsible for developing and administrating training to support the operations of the Clearance Verification Unit, Appeals Unit, and Quality Assurance Administrative Support Unit. Your duties will include training new clerical staff in standard operating procedures, tools, and policies. In this position, you will be responsible for onboarding new staff by requesting access to computer applications and databases and offboarding departing staff who are no longer authorized. You can expect to provide ongoing training to existing clerical employees to support continuous improvement in service quality and operational efficiency. Additionally, you will develop and maintain a comprehensive training curriculum and resource guides.

REQUIRED EXPERIENCE, TRAINING & ELIGIBILITY
QUALIFICATIONS
Minimum Experience and Training Requirements:
+ Two years of experience in varied office management or staff work; and bachelor's degree; or
+ Any equivalent combination of experience and training.
Other Requirements:
+ You must meet the PA residency requirement (https://www.employment.pa.gov/Additional%20Info/Pages/default.aspx) . For more information on ways to meet PA residency requirements, follow the link (https://www.employment.pa.gov/Additional%20Info/Pages/default.aspx) and click on Residency.
+ You must be able to perform essential job functions.
Legal Requirements:
+ This position falls under the provisions of the Child Protective Services Law.
+ Under the Law, a conditional offer of employment will require submission and approval of satisfactory criminal history reports including, but not limited to, PA State Police clearance, PA Child Abuse history clearance, and FBI Fingerprint clearance.
